Manuel Antonio
Zip Line Canopy Tour
Did you know that the zip line canopy tour has been invented in Costa Rica? It was a biologist that decided to see what going on, on the rainforest tree tops. Quepos-Manuel Antonio offers an alternative to visit the rainforest, from very different perspective. The zip line course and platforms are located above and into the primary and secondary rainforest. A professional nature guide will help you ¿fly¿ from platform to platform, and it will be your turn to discover what going on the rainforest tree tops.

Ocean King Catamaran Cruise & Snorkel
The catamaran will chart a picturesque course departing from Quepos gliding around the back of Manuel Antonio National Park. Your guide will point out notable wildlife and vegetation specimens, so be sure to have your camera ready. You will pass by panoramas adorned with islands, cliffs and rock formations. You can admire aviary nesting grounds and marine wildlife. Beverages and snacks are available onboard the catamaran throughout the trip. After touring the coastline, your captain will set anchor on Bisanz beach where you can take advantage of the pit stop to snorkel at this secluded bay. You are most likely to spot parrotfish, starfish, angelfish and if you are lucky a dolphin!

Horseback Ride to La Fortuna Waterfall
The La Fortuna waterfall tour starts traveling horseback for 5.5 kilometers until you arrive to the horses rest site. Once here you will receive a quick introduction before setting off on your exciting horseback ride. Through this tour you will be able to see firsthand Costa Rica's rural way of life. You will ride past cattle farms and agriculture sites. As you get to the entrance of La Fortuna Waterfall, the horses will be left in a resting place to start the hike of 530 stairs through the forest in a deep canyon that will lead you into an impressive 230-foot-high waterfall. This natural wonder emerges from an emerald-colored jungle cliff into a natural pool where you can swim in the cold mountain waters for about one hour (weather permitting). However if you do not want to swim enjoy at the riverside of the scenic beauty of the natural surroundings and take some unforgettable pictures while hearing the sounds of nature.

Palo Verde National Park
Palo Verde National Park is located on over 45,500 acres of land that are protected by law. Palo Verde is part of a geographical unit known in Spanish as Bajuras del Tempisque (the lowlands of the Tempisque River). You¿ll find around 12 different types of habitats, including four different species of mangrove trees, 55 aquatic plants, including water hyacinths, and 150 species of trees, like the one from which the Park¿s name is taken. The visit to this location will consist of a boat ride along the Tempisque River. You will also enjoy the life style to the ¿Sabanero¿ and delicious homemade snacks. Fruits will be served at the Hacienda House, built in the XIX Century.
